Power door locks on both doors dont work
The most likely cause of that concern would be a broken power or ground wire in the umbilical between the body and the driver's door. The second most likely cause would be a defective master (driver's) window control switch.

Is the idle air valve an acceleration problem? It
No to both questions. The idle valve is only for idle control, letting in more or less air as idle conditions warrant, to keep engine at proper idle RPM. The old choke would reduce air supply on a cold engine to allow starting with a richer gas mixture. That function is taken over by the computer in injected cars by allowing longer injector pulses to give richer mixtures in cold engines. Once warm, the 02 sensor controls fuel trim through the computer.By "accelerating itself", do you mean your idle is higher now that it's colder outside? I suppose it's possible if the idle valve is out of calibration, it might cause that. It is computer controlled, so proper diagnosis of the idle control valve requires a multimeter. The throttle position sensor should also be looked at for a high idle. Good luck.
The engine stutters when the car takes off
I would change the fuel filter, and have your fuel pressure checked for a possible low pressure problem.If that is alright, consider a tune-up with new plugs, possibly new plug wires, distributor cap, and rotor. Also, check your air filter.Keep the old ones running! Makes my day.
